Recent Actions Dealing with Risk and Uncertainty
Southwest Airlines just like any other airline company, faces risks and uncertainties.
These risks threaten their future statements and profitability. Some of the uncertainties facing the
company include high costs of aircraft fuel, effects of fuel hedging activities, and the possibility
of accidents. Further, there are risks of breaches of the information technology infrastructure,
labor issues, pending litigations, natural disasters, and competition from other airlines
(Southwest Airlines Co., 2018). This year the Airline experienced its first fatal accident in over
fifty-one years of service.
The company recently performed some activities to handle these uncertainties. It
inspected all their aircrafts especially the engines following the accident to prevent further
incidences. It launched new travel destinations with flights to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ky
International Airport, Owen Roberts International Airport in Grand Cayman and Providenciales
Airport in Turks and Caicos. These efforts are to offer its customers access to these areas and
deal with competition by venturing into new markets. It also completed the installation of a new
